Address N8b6FELXQZokCcZ6yDi5B1bwrt8oAYLzPG

Total received 19.88848300 NMC
Total sent 19.88848300 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 14, 2017, 9:43 p.m. a3b2cc75d… 346289 19.88848300 NMC 0.00000000 NMC
June 14, 2017, 9:34 p.m. 205810c1d… 346288 19.88848300 NMC 19.88848300 NMC